The Significance of Steel Pipe Valves

Controlling Fluid Flow and Pressure:
Steel pipe valves are instrumental in regulating the flow and pressure of fluids and gases within pipelines and systems. These valves allow precise control, enabling operators to adjust the flow rates, divert or stop the flow, and maintain optimal pressure levels. By effectively managing fluid dynamics, steel pipe valves ensure efficient and balanced operations in industrial processes.

Ensuring System Safety and Reliability:
Steel pipe valves act as critical safety devices, preventing potential accidents and protecting equipment and personnel. With their ability to isolate sections of pipelines or systems, these valves allow for swift shutdowns during emergencies or maintenance activities. By providing reliable control over fluid flow, steel pipe valves safeguard against leaks, overpressures, and other hazardous situations.

Key Functions of Steel Pipe Valves

Regulation and Isolation:
Steel pipe valves facilitate precise regulation of fluid flow, enabling operators to fine-tune the desired flow rates and maintain process efficiency. Additionally, these valves serve as isolation devices, allowing specific sections of pipelines or systems to be shut off for maintenance, repairs, or safety purposes. The ability to regulate and isolate fluid flow makes steel pipe valves indispensable components in various industries.

Backflow Prevention and Directional Control:
Steel pipe valves play a crucial role in preventing backflow, which occurs when fluids or gases flow in the opposite direction. Backflow prevention valves ensure that the flow remains unidirectional, preventing contamination and maintaining the integrity of the process. Furthermore, steel pipe valves provide directional control, allowing operators to direct the flow to specific areas within the system as needed.

Diverse Applications of Steel Pipe Valves

Oil and Gas Industry: Pipeline Control:
In the oil and gas industry, steel pipe valves are integral to the control and distribution of petroleum products. These valves regulate the flow of oil and gas within pipelines, ensuring efficient transportation and distribution. Steel pipe valves enable operators to manage the flow rates, isolate sections for maintenance, and prevent leaks, contributing to the overall safety and reliability of the pipeline infrastructure.

Manufacturing Sector: Process Optimization:
In the manufacturing sector, steel pipe valves are vital for optimizing industrial processes. These valves control the flow of various fluids used in manufacturing operations, such as cooling water, chemicals, and compressed air. By ensuring precise flow control and efficient distribution, steel pipe valves enhance productivity, reduce waste, and maintain consistent quality in manufacturing processes.
